The Significance Of Play Integrity An In-Depth Discussion
Introduction: Understanding Play Integrity
Play Integrity, often discussed in the context of mobile gaming and app development, is a concept that might not immediately resonate with everyone. However, for developers, gamers, and the broader mobile ecosystem, play integrity is fundamentally important. This article delves into why play integrity is significant, exploring its various facets, challenges, and implications. It aims to clarify the importance of maintaining a fair and secure app environment, ensuring a positive experience for all users involved.
In the digital age, where applications are becoming increasingly sophisticated and integral to our daily lives, the need to preserve play integrity cannot be overstated. From preventing cheating and fraud to protecting user data and developer revenue, the principles of play integrity are crucial for a healthy and sustainable app ecosystem. This discussion will explore how play integrity works, why it matters, and the strategies employed to uphold it, offering a comprehensive view of its significance in today’s technological landscape. Maintaining play integrity is not merely a technical issue; it's a commitment to fairness, security, and trust within the digital realm.
What is Play Integrity?
At its core, play integrity refers to the authenticity and reliability of an application environment. It encompasses various measures and systems designed to ensure that an application is running in a safe, legitimate, and unaltered environment. This means verifying that the application hasn't been tampered with, is running on a genuine device, and is free from unauthorized modifications or cheating mechanisms. Play integrity is about building a secure foundation for apps, allowing developers to trust the conditions under which their applications operate and ensuring that users can engage with apps without encountering unfair advantages or risks.
The concept of play integrity extends beyond simply preventing cheating in games; it encompasses the broader security of the application ecosystem. It involves verifying the integrity of both the application itself and the environment in which it's running. This includes detecting and preventing various forms of fraud, such as unauthorized installations, piracy, and the use of emulators or rooted devices. By safeguarding against these threats, play integrity helps maintain a level playing field for all users and protects developers from potential revenue loss and reputational damage.
To truly appreciate the importance of play integrity, one must understand the intricate web of technologies and protocols that work in tandem to uphold it. From cryptographic checks and tamper detection to device attestation and environment validation, the mechanisms behind play integrity are complex and continuously evolving. These measures not only deter malicious activities but also provide a framework for trust, ensuring that every interaction within the application ecosystem is grounded in security and fairness. In essence, play integrity is the bedrock upon which a vibrant and sustainable app ecosystem is built, fostering confidence among users and developers alike.
Why Play Integrity Matters: The Key Benefits
The importance of play integrity stems from the numerous benefits it brings to various stakeholders within the app ecosystem. These advantages range from enhancing user experience and safeguarding developer revenue to ensuring fair gameplay and protecting data security. Let's explore the key benefits of play integrity in detail, highlighting why it is not just a technical necessity but a crucial element for the overall health and sustainability of the mobile app environment.
One of the primary benefits of play integrity is the improved user experience it provides. By preventing cheating and unauthorized modifications, play integrity helps create a level playing field where all users have an equal opportunity to succeed. This is especially critical in multiplayer games, where unfair advantages can ruin the experience for legitimate players. By ensuring a fair gaming environment, play integrity fosters a sense of trust and enjoyment, encouraging users to remain engaged and invested in the game. Beyond gaming, play integrity enhances the overall app experience by preventing fraud and abuse, which can disrupt functionality and compromise the integrity of the app's features. A secure and fair environment translates to happier users, fostering loyalty and positive word-of-mouth.
Furthermore, play integrity plays a pivotal role in protecting developer revenue. Piracy, unauthorized installations, and the use of cracked versions of apps can significantly impact a developer's earnings. By implementing play integrity measures, developers can safeguard their intellectual property and ensure that users are accessing legitimate versions of their apps. This not only protects revenue streams but also incentivizes developers to continue creating high-quality content and innovative experiences. In addition, play integrity helps developers maintain control over their distribution channels, preventing unauthorized distribution and ensuring that app updates and patches are correctly applied. This level of control is crucial for maintaining the integrity of the app and delivering the best possible user experience. Ensuring play integrity is a strategic investment that pays dividends in the form of sustained revenue and a thriving app ecosystem.
Data security is another crucial aspect of play integrity. In an era where data breaches and privacy concerns are rampant, ensuring the security of user data is paramount. Play integrity measures can help prevent unauthorized access to sensitive information by verifying the integrity of the app environment and detecting malicious activities. By preventing tampering and unauthorized modifications, play integrity helps protect user data from being compromised, ensuring compliance with privacy regulations and building trust with users. This is particularly important for apps that handle personal or financial information, where security breaches can have severe consequences. Play integrity acts as a first line of defense against data breaches, providing a secure foundation for app operations and safeguarding user privacy.
The Challenges in Maintaining Play Integrity
Maintaining play integrity is not without its challenges. The landscape of threats and vulnerabilities is constantly evolving, requiring developers and platform providers to stay one step ahead of malicious actors. From sophisticated cheating techniques to advanced methods of bypassing security measures, the obstacles to preserving play integrity are complex and multifaceted. Understanding these challenges is essential for devising effective strategies to combat them. In this section, we will explore the key hurdles in maintaining play integrity, shedding light on the complexities and ongoing efforts required to uphold a secure app environment.
One of the foremost challenges in play integrity is the constant evolution of cheating techniques. As security measures become more sophisticated, so do the methods employed by cheaters. Hackers and malicious actors continuously develop new ways to exploit vulnerabilities, bypass security checks, and gain unfair advantages. This cat-and-mouse game requires a proactive approach to security, with developers and platform providers constantly monitoring for new threats and adapting their defenses accordingly. Staying ahead of the curve involves leveraging advanced technologies, such as machine learning and artificial intelligence, to detect and respond to emerging threats in real-time. The dynamic nature of cheating underscores the need for continuous vigilance and innovation in maintaining play integrity.
Another significant challenge is the diversity of devices and operating systems. The mobile ecosystem is highly fragmented, with a wide range of devices, operating system versions, and hardware configurations. This fragmentation creates a complex landscape for security, as different devices and platforms may have varying levels of security and different vulnerabilities. Ensuring play integrity across this diverse ecosystem requires a comprehensive and adaptable approach, with security measures tailored to the specific characteristics of each device and platform. This can be a resource-intensive undertaking, requiring developers to test and optimize their security measures across a wide range of devices. However, addressing this challenge is crucial for ensuring a consistent and secure experience for all users.
The use of emulators and rooted devices also poses a significant threat to play integrity. Emulators allow users to run mobile apps on their computers, which can make it easier to cheat or tamper with the app. Rooted devices, on the other hand, provide users with privileged access to the operating system, allowing them to modify the app's code or environment. Both emulators and rooted devices can bypass security measures designed to prevent cheating and fraud, making it challenging to maintain play integrity. Detecting and preventing the use of emulators and rooted devices requires sophisticated techniques, such as device attestation and environment validation. However, even these measures can be circumvented by determined attackers, highlighting the ongoing need for vigilance and innovation in play integrity.
Strategies for Upholding Play Integrity
In response to the challenges outlined above, developers and platform providers employ a range of strategies to uphold play integrity. These strategies encompass technical measures, policy enforcement, and community engagement, all working in concert to create a secure and fair app environment. From implementing robust security checks to fostering a culture of integrity within the user base, the strategies for maintaining play integrity are diverse and multifaceted. This section will explore the key strategies used to safeguard play integrity, highlighting the importance of a comprehensive and collaborative approach.
One of the primary strategies for upholding play integrity is the implementation of robust security checks and tamper detection mechanisms. These measures are designed to verify the integrity of the app environment and detect any unauthorized modifications or tampering. Security checks can include cryptographic signatures, checksums, and other techniques to ensure that the app hasn't been altered. Tamper detection mechanisms, on the other hand, monitor the app's runtime environment for suspicious activities, such as code injection or memory manipulation. By detecting and preventing tampering, these measures help ensure that the app is running in a safe and legitimate environment. Implementing effective security checks and tamper detection requires a deep understanding of potential vulnerabilities and attack vectors, as well as a commitment to continuous monitoring and improvement.
Another crucial strategy for play integrity is device attestation. Device attestation involves verifying the integrity and authenticity of the device on which the app is running. This can include checking the device's hardware and software configuration, as well as verifying its security status. By attesting to the device's integrity, developers can ensure that the app is running on a genuine device that hasn't been compromised. Device attestation can also help detect the use of emulators or rooted devices, which are often used for cheating or unauthorized modifications. Implementing device attestation requires close collaboration with platform providers and device manufacturers, as well as the use of specialized APIs and technologies. However, the benefits of device attestation in terms of play integrity are significant, making it a critical component of a comprehensive security strategy.
Policy enforcement is also essential for upholding play integrity. Developers and platform providers must establish clear policies regarding cheating, fraud, and other forms of abuse, and enforce these policies consistently. This can include implementing bans or suspensions for users who violate the policies, as well as removing or blocking apps that are found to be engaging in malicious activities. Effective policy enforcement requires a robust monitoring system, as well as a fair and transparent process for investigating and resolving violations. By enforcing policies consistently, developers and platform providers can create a culture of integrity within the user base and deter malicious actors. Policy enforcement is not just about punishing offenders; it's about setting clear expectations and promoting a safe and fair environment for all users.
The Future of Play Integrity
The future of play integrity is poised to be shaped by ongoing technological advancements and the evolving landscape of threats and vulnerabilities. As apps become more sophisticated and integral to our daily lives, the need to preserve play integrity will only continue to grow. From the integration of artificial intelligence and machine learning to the development of new security protocols, the future of play integrity is dynamic and promising. This section explores the potential future trends and developments in play integrity, highlighting the importance of innovation and collaboration in maintaining a secure app environment.
One of the key trends shaping the future of play integrity is the increasing use of artificial intelligence (AI) and machine learning (ML). AI and ML technologies can be used to detect and respond to threats in real-time, making it easier to stay ahead of malicious actors. For example, AI can be used to analyze user behavior and identify patterns that may indicate cheating or fraud. ML algorithms can also be trained to detect and classify new threats, allowing security measures to adapt and evolve over time. The integration of AI and ML into play integrity systems represents a significant advancement, enabling more proactive and effective security measures. However, it also presents new challenges, such as the need to ensure the fairness and transparency of AI-driven security systems.
Another important trend is the development of new security protocols and technologies. As existing security measures are circumvented, new and innovative approaches are needed to maintain play integrity. This can include the development of more robust tamper detection mechanisms, as well as new methods for device attestation and environment validation. One promising area of research is the use of blockchain technology for security, which can provide a tamper-proof and transparent record of app integrity. The ongoing development of new security protocols is essential for staying ahead of emerging threats and maintaining a secure app environment.
Collaboration between developers, platform providers, and security experts will also play a crucial role in the future of play integrity. Sharing threat intelligence, best practices, and innovative solutions can help create a more robust and resilient ecosystem. Collaboration can also facilitate the development of industry standards and guidelines for play integrity, ensuring a consistent and effective approach across different platforms and apps. The challenges of maintaining play integrity are complex and multifaceted, requiring a collective effort to address them effectively. By fostering collaboration and knowledge sharing, the industry can enhance its ability to protect against threats and maintain a fair and secure app environment.
Conclusion: Play Integrity as a Cornerstone of the App Ecosystem
In conclusion, play integrity is not merely a technical concern; it is a fundamental aspect of the app ecosystem. Its significance spans across various dimensions, impacting user experience, developer revenue, data security, and the overall health of the digital environment. From preventing cheating in games to safeguarding user data, play integrity serves as a cornerstone for trust and fairness within the app ecosystem. The ongoing efforts to uphold play integrity reflect a commitment to creating a secure, equitable, and sustainable environment for all stakeholders. As technology continues to evolve, the importance of play integrity will only continue to grow, necessitating a proactive and collaborative approach to ensure its preservation.
By ensuring a level playing field, play integrity enhances the user experience, fostering engagement and loyalty. Users are more likely to invest their time and resources in apps that provide a fair and secure environment, free from cheating and fraud. This, in turn, benefits developers by creating a more sustainable business model and encouraging the creation of high-quality content. Play integrity protects developer revenue by preventing piracy and unauthorized installations, ensuring that developers are fairly compensated for their work. This is crucial for incentivizing innovation and sustaining the app ecosystem. Moreover, play integrity plays a vital role in safeguarding user data, protecting sensitive information from unauthorized access and breaches. In an era where data privacy is paramount, play integrity is an essential component of a comprehensive security strategy.
Looking ahead, maintaining play integrity will require a continuous commitment to innovation and collaboration. The challenges are complex and ever-evolving, demanding a proactive approach that anticipates and addresses emerging threats. From leveraging AI and machine learning to developing new security protocols, the future of play integrity is dynamic and promising. However, success will depend on the collective efforts of developers, platform providers, security experts, and the broader community. By working together and sharing knowledge, the industry can ensure that play integrity remains a cornerstone of the app ecosystem, fostering a secure, fair, and vibrant digital environment for all. In essence, play integrity is not just about protecting apps; it's about safeguarding the very fabric of trust and fairness upon which the digital world is built.